Output 58257c01359fed5533ca841b60a99fc1bd70fc68fbbec8e6e2cc42df868347e8:518

value
21892
script pubkey
OP_0 OP_PUSHBYTES_20 c3f3de0acd9060b53b8a59e61a17bb2f1f89a0f5
address
ltc1qc0eauzkdjpst2wu2t8np59am9u0cng84pgvvce
transaction
58257c01359fed5533ca841b60a99fc1bd70fc68fbbec8e6e2cc42df868347e8
spent
true